一聚教程网:一个值得你收藏的教程网站

最新下载

热门教程

Debian Crontab如何配置任务执行参数

时间:2026-06-16 09:21:48 编辑:袖梨 来源:一聚教程网

在Debian系统中,使用crontab来设置定时任务。要为任务设置执行参数,你需要在编辑crontab文件时指定这些参数。以下是设置任务执行参数的步骤:

Debian Crontab如何设置任务执行参数

  1. 打开终端。

  2. 输入crontab -e命令来编辑当前用户的crontab文件。如果你需要以root用户身份编辑crontab文件,请使用sudo crontab -e命令。

  3. 在打开的crontab文件中,你可以添加一行来定义定时任务及其参数。Crontab文件的每一行都表示一个任务,包含6个字段,分别是:

    * * * * * command-to-be-executed└─┬─┘└─┬─┘└─┬─┘└─┬─┘└─┬─┘│ │ │ │ ││ │ │ │ ││ │ │ │ └───── 星期 (0 - 7) (星期天可以是0或7)│ │ │ └───────────── 月份 (1 - 12)│ │ └───────────────────── 日期 (1 - 31)│ └───────────────────────────── 星期几 (0 - 7) (星期天可以是0或7)└───────────────────────────────────── 小时 (0 - 23)

    command-to-be-executed部分,你可以添加你需要执行的命令,并在命令后附加参数。例如:

    * * * * * /path/to/your/script.sh arg1 arg2 arg3

    这将每分钟执行/path/to/your/script.sh脚本,并传递arg1arg2arg3作为参数。

  4. 保存并关闭crontab文件。在大多数编辑器中,你可以按Ctrl + X,然后按Y,最后按Enter来保存更改。

  5. 要检查你的crontab文件是否已成功更新,可以输入crontab -l命令来查看当前用户的所有定时任务。

现在,你已经成功设置了带有参数的定时任务。请确保你的脚本具有可执行权限,并根据需要调整任务的时间表达式。

热门栏目